Warm Springs is an unincorporated community and census-designated place (CDP) in Randolph County, Arkansas, United States. Warm Springs is located on Arkansas Highway 251, 15.5 miles (24.9 km) north-northwest of Pocahontas. It was first listed as a CDP in the 2020 census with a population of 47.[2]

Warm Springs has a ZIP Code of 72478, but does not have a post office nor a collection box.[3]
